RP1700 Posté(e) 15 mai 2002 Posté(e) 15 mai 2002 j'ai un problème avec l'instruction print : si je mets <?php print ("Bonjour"); ?> il m'affiche : Bonjour"); ?> vu que je débute en php, je voudrai bien savoir pourquoi il n'affiche pas simplement bonjour Citer
RP1700 Posté(e) 15 mai 2002 Auteur Posté(e) 15 mai 2002 pour moi aussi, c'est pour ça queje pose la question :lol: Citer
m@nOO Posté(e) 15 mai 2002 Posté(e) 15 mai 2002 zarb ton truc je viens de tester sur mon serveur çà marche au poil :??: http://manoo.d2g.com/test/hello.php Seul différence je ne suis pas avec easyphp mais c kifkif, apache+php+mysql+phpmyadmin ;) ben moi aussi j'ai une petite préférence pour la fonction echo (qui fait là même chose) sinon vous trouverez la doc php là http://www.php.net/manual/fr/ ou pour faciliter les recherches download du fichier .chm (htmlHelp) là http://dev.nexen.net/docs/php/chargement.html d'ailleurs <?php print "Bonjour"; ?> fonctionne aussi ;) Citer
RP1700 Posté(e) 16 mai 2002 Auteur Posté(e) 16 mai 2002 ok merci, je viens de telecharger la doc en version longue je vais voir ce que je peux en tirer Citer
m@nOO Posté(e) 16 mai 2002 Posté(e) 16 mai 2002 ok merci, je viens de telecharger la doc en version longue je vais voir ce que je peux en tirer euh nan le .chm - 3ème format de fichier - c'est le plus cool pour faire des recherches plein texte et avec un index. Citer
m@nOO Posté(e) 16 mai 2002 Posté(e) 16 mai 2002 sinon tu es sûr qu'il ne t'affiche pas tout <?php print ("Bonjour"); ?> car juste çà Bonjour"); ?> çà me parait bizarre :??: donnes un peu + d'infos sur comment tu as procédé de A à Z. Citer
RP1700 Posté(e) 16 mai 2002 Auteur Posté(e) 16 mai 2002 j'ai tapé exactement çà : <HTML> <HEAD> <TITLE>Bonjour</TITLE> </HEAD> <?php print ("bonjour"); ?> </HTML> il m'affiche : bonjour"); ?> Citer
Klem3i1 Posté(e) 16 mai 2002 Posté(e) 16 mai 2002 J'y connais rien mais il ne devrait pas y avoir des balises <body> ? Ce qui ferait ça: <HTML> <HEAD> <TITLE>Bonjour</TITLE> </HEAD> <BODY> <?php print ("bonjour"); ?> </BODY> </HTML> Citer
m@nOO Posté(e) 16 mai 2002 Posté(e) 16 mai 2002 essaie en mettant juste çà comme code <?php print ("Bonjour"); ?> sans balise HTML ie arrive très bien l'ingurgiter sans HTML. Sinon c'est vrai que si on est puriste <body></body> est obligatoire. une autre petite adresse pour valider votre code HTML 4.01 c'est très sympa et çà permet de relever très facilement les erreurs ;) http://validator.w3.org autre petit test que tu peux faire pour voir si tout fonctionne bien avec easyphp <?php phpinfo() ?> çà va te donner l'état de ton serveur apache, les librairies installés, les variables .... et sutout permet de contrôler que php est bien là ;) exemple http://manoo.d2g.com/phpinfo.php Citer
m@nOO Posté(e) 16 mai 2002 Posté(e) 16 mai 2002 j'ai tapé exactement çà : <HTML> <HEAD> <TITLE>Bonjour</TITLE> </HEAD> <?php print ("bonjour"); ?> </HTML> je viens de faire un copier/coller et de tester sur mon serveur au taf et çà marche très bien. Doit y'avoir un problème dans ton install easyphp :( [edit]: je viens de d/l easyphp 1.6, j'ai installé j'ai mis ton code et çà marche !! Citer
RP1700 Posté(e) 16 mai 2002 Auteur Posté(e) 16 mai 2002 je vais peut être attendre la confirmation d'ouverture de compte par free pour tester, mais autrement, sur mon ordinateur personnel, il ne veut pas faire comme il faut Citer
m@nOO Posté(e) 16 mai 2002 Posté(e) 16 mai 2002 ben sur free çà va marcher forcément ;) c qd même plus sympa de tester en local avant d'uploader. t'as pas d'autres infos à nous filer ?? Easyphp est bien démarré avec le voyant apache en vert ? quand tu choisis "web local" dans le menu il t'affiche bien la première page du serveur local (correspond au fichier index.php dans le repertoire program fileseasyphpwww ) ?? t'as testé les autres trucs qu'on t'a filé ?? ton fichier comment l'as-tu appelé ? où l'as-tu mis ? quelle URL utilises-tu pour l'afficher ? c peut-être un truc tout con, mais ton code est juste c sûr ! Citer
RP1700 Posté(e) 16 mai 2002 Auteur Posté(e) 16 mai 2002 quand je mets sur web local il m'affiche une page qui me permet plusieurs trucs, dont l'éxécution de phpinfo. le fichier s'apelle azerty.php, maintenant c'est encore mieux : il ne veut rien afficher, euh non, il affiche bonjour "); ?> mais il faut que je mette le texte en html : echo("<b><center>bonjour</center></b>") Citer
m@nOO Posté(e) 17 mai 2002 Posté(e) 17 mai 2002 easy php 1.5php 4.0.6 ben désinstalle et essaie avec la 1.6 version plus récente apache 1.3.24 php 4.2.0 phpmyadmin 2.2.6 mysql 3.23.49 je ne pense pas que çà vienne de là mais sait-on jamais ;) Citer
RP1700 Posté(e) 17 mai 2002 Auteur Posté(e) 17 mai 2002 ok je vais essayer, mais il va falloir attendre car j'ai plus guère de forfait internet et il va falloir attendre le 28 pour qu j'ai à nouveau 50H, alors, je préfère attendre les 50 heures au lieu de bousiller mon crédit en telechargement, mais je vaisquand même voir la taille du fichier, s'il est pas trop lourd j led/l Citer
RP1700 Posté(e) 18 mai 2002 Auteur Posté(e) 18 mai 2002 désolé, mais il ne me reste que 90 minutes de forfait, je préfère surfer un peu et attendre le 28 pour avoir mes 50H Citer
Messages recommandés
Rejoindre la conversation
Vous pouvez publier maintenant et vous inscrire plus tard. Si vous avez un compte, connectez-vous maintenant pour publier avec votre compte.